Ford Targets Further Water Usage Reduction by 2020

In a recent press release from the Ford Motor Company, the automaker announced a new goal of reducing its water usage for the vehicle manufacturing process. By the year 2020, Ford aims to reduce its water usage per vehicle by nearly three-fourths, saving more than 10 billion gallons of water. Ford fights climate change with sustainably engineered plastics

If you're anything like us, you're concerned about the environment. With April shattering the global temperature average, the threat of climate change has never been more real or present. But we can each to do our part to help combat climate change, and Ford is leading the charge. Earlier today, Ford announced that it had developed a sustainable new practice to manufacture automotive plastics and foam via recaptured carbon emissions.
